Overview — Why In-Stream Ads Matter

In-stream ads are video advertisements placed inside eligible creator videos. They appear as pre-roll (before video), mid-roll (during video), or post-roll (after video). Facebook shares revenue with creators, making in-stream ads one of the strongest sources of passive income on the platform. Instead of depending on unpredictable viral videos, you earn from consistent viewer retention and meaningful watch-time performance.

While many new creators assume they need millions of views to qualify, the truth is that Facebook prioritizes policy compliance, content originality, and steady watch-time over large follower counts. This is why smaller creators who publish structured, valuable content often qualify faster than large creators who only chase trends.

Eligibility Checklist

  • A professional Page or profile set to "Professional Mode."
  • Location in a country where in-stream ads are supported.
  • No significant violations in the last 90 days.
  • Original content that adheres to Facebook Partner Monetization Policies.
  • Video content with strong watch-time performance.
  • Completion of payouts setup once approved.

These requirements ensure Facebook only monetizes creators who deliver consistent value and follow platform rules. Even if you meet all metrics, policy violations can block eligibility. Quality + compliance = approval.

What Facebook Measures Before Approval

Approval isn’t random — Facebook evaluates several performance indicators:

  • Minutes viewed: Total watch time across your Page.
  • Retention: How long viewers stay on your videos.
  • Content originality: Reused content slows or prevents approval.
  • Engagement quality: Comments + shares, not just views.
  • Upload consistency: Steady posting signals reliability.

Your goal is to build signals that show Facebook you can keep viewers watching naturally.

8-Week Step-by-Step Plan to Qualify

Week 1: Audit your Page. Remove reused content, fix descriptions, and identify your top-performing topics.

Week 2: Publish two 6–10 minute videos + two Reels. Long videos build watch-time. Reels build discovery.

Week 3: Improve thumbnails and titles. Your first 10 seconds must be structured with a strong hook.

Week 4: Start a weekly series. Series encourage repeat viewers — a key signal for monetization.

Week 5: Add storytelling frameworks, transitions, and on-screen prompts that keep viewers watching.

Week 6: Use Live videos to spike watch-time. One 15-minute Live can outperform five short videos.

Week 7: Analyze retention charts. Fix drop-off points and test new formats based on performance.

Week 8: Reapply or wait for approval. If not approved, repeat the cycle — most creators get in on the second cycle.

Case Study — Creator Who Qualified in 7 Weeks

A creator with 5,200 followers posted four 8-minute tutorials weekly and one 20-minute Live session every weekend. Her average retention improved from 22% to 41%, and her watch-time tripled within 4 weeks. Facebook offered monetization access in Week 7.

Lesson: Consistency + helpful content + a clear structure beats unreliable viral videos.

How to Maintain Eligibility After Approval

Once you qualify, continue publishing long-form videos to maintain strong watch-time. Avoid re-uploading TikTok content, violating policies, or drastically changing your niche. Stability improves ad RPM and revenue.

Common Mistakes That Delay Approval

  • Using reused content or borrowed clips
  • Publishing short videos only
  • Ignoring policy violations
  • Inconsistent posting schedule
  • Starting too many niches at once
